About This Home
Welcome to the newly renovated 53 Madison Dr! This well-built brick, 3-bedroom, 1-bath townhome sits in the heart of the City of Newark, in the College Park Neighborhood, right off South Main Street. There is a designated parking space in the rear of the property, street parking and a large parking lot next to Dickey Park. The property conveniently sits within walking/biking distance to the University of Delaware, UD and DART bus stops, a plethora of restaurants and two shopping centers including Suburban Plaza and Park N' Shop. The College Park Community has direct access to Edna C Dickey Park which has numerous recreational facilities, including a community garden, basketball court, street hockey court, pavilion, swimming pool, baseball diamond and playground. Landlord pays trash/recycling, heat, water/sewer. $50 rental application fee per person, 18 years and older.
53 Madison Dr is a townhome located in New Castle County and the 19711 ZIP Code. This area is served by the Christina School District attendance zone.

Located in New Castle County, Newark combines college-town energy with suburban living. As home to the University of Delaware, the city's Main Street features local restaurants and shops that serve both students and long-term residents. The rental market accommodates various needs, from apartments near campus to residential communities throughout the city. Current average rents range from $1,226 for studios to $2,879 for four-bedroom homes. One-bedroom units average $1,459, reflecting a 2.2% annual increase, positioning Newark as an accessible option within the Delaware Valley region.
Founded in 1694 by Scots-Irish and Welsh settlers, Newark maintains strong connections to its past while embracing modern life. The city encompasses over 12,000 acres of parkland, including White Clay Creek State Park and Iron Hill Park, offering extensive trail systems for outdoor recreation. The University of Delaware enhances the community through performing arts events and NCAA Division I athletics.
